Abstract

The utility model discloses a single-arm turnover machine for carpenters, which comprises a frame, a drive control mechanism, an input power roller bench, an output power roller bench and a turnover mechanism. The drive control mechanism, the input power roller bench, the output power roller bench and the turnover mechanism are arranged on the frame. The input power roller bench and the output power roller bench are respectively connected with the drive control mechanism. The turnover mechanism is arranged at the central section of the input power roller bench and the output power roller bench. The turnover mechanism comprises two or more sets of turnover arms for overturning plates. The turnover arms are equipped with two or more automatic clamping devices, so that plates are effectively clamped to the turnover arms through the automatic clamping devices and rotated at 180 degrees. The collision of the turnover arms and plates during the turnover process is avoided, so that the integrity of the plates is ensured. Meanwhile, the single-arm turnover machine has no restriction on the sizes of plates and the service space is greatly increased. The single-arm turnover machine is flexible to use and the automation control of the machine is strengthened. The excessive input of manpower and material resources is avoided and the safety of human bodies is effectively ensured. The production efficiency is also improved.

Description

The single armed tipper that a kind of carpenter uses
Technical field
The utility model relates to the auxiliary equipment in a kind of woodworking machinery production equipment, the single armed tipper that particularly a kind of carpenter uses.
Background technology
Existing woodwork industry is in the process of sheet material processing, and the application of tipper in the woodworking machinery process more and more widely used, and sheet material is turned to the program of the processing that could accomplish the another side from a side through using tipper.Though used tipper at production line; Production efficiency is improved; But existing tipper does not generally have clamping device, and in the sheet material upset, certain collision takes place the sheet material arm that turns over easy and tipper; Plate surface is produced certain damage, cause unnecessary economic loss.And, because the little restriction that receives size again of upset loading capacity of present tipper, the short and little sheet material of weight of the size of can only overturning, inapplicable large-sized sheet material.And mostly be to utilize crane for the upset of large-sized sheet material, lean on artificial the realization, not only increased working strength of workers and work difficulty, have serious personal safety hidden danger, and production efficiency is low, can't adapt to the requirement of the production of mechanical automation efficiently.
Summary of the invention
The purpose of the utility model is to overcome the deficiency of prior art; Provide simple in structure, avoid sheet material and flip-arm generation bump and guarantee the sheet material integrality, and the single armed tipper that the sheet material automation mechanized operation intensity again of suitable all size is high, use is flexible safely, carpenter that effectively enhance productivity uses.
The goal of the invention of the utility model is achieved in that the single armed tipper that a kind of carpenter uses; Comprise frame, be installed on drive controlling mechanism, input live roll platform, outputting power roller platform and switching mechanism on the frame; Input live roll platform, outputting power roller platform are connected with drive controlling mechanism respectively; It is characterized in that: said switching mechanism is arranged at the middle part of input live roll platform, outputting power roller platform, and switching mechanism is provided with the flip-arm of the sheet material that is used to more than two groups or two groups to overturn, and flip-arm is provided with the automatic clamping device more than two or two; Automatic clamping device is fixedly installed on the flip-arm; Automatic clamping device lock onto sheet material on the flip-arm, drives flip-arm through switching mechanism, thereby sheet material is turn on the outputting power roller platform by input live roll platform 180 degree.
Said switching mechanism comprises upset motor, trip shaft; Trip shaft, upset motor are fixed in input live roll platform and outputting power roller platform middle part through support; The upset motor is placed in the top of trip shaft, and trip shaft is connected with the motor that overturns, and flip-arm is fixedly installed on the trip shaft respectively.
Said trip shaft end is provided with the electrical signal device that is used to control reversal rate.
The framework setting that is square of said flip-arm, it comprises side frame, side frame, left frame and right frame down.
Said automatic clamping device is placed on the last side frame of flip-arm, and the following side frame of flip-arm is arranged side by side each other with input live roll table top or outputting power roller table top.
Said automatic clamping device clamps cylinder is fixed in flip-arm through securing member last side frame for clamping cylinder.
The piston rod of said clamping cylinder is provided with the roof pressure piece that is used to lock sheet material.
The right frame end of said flip-arm is provided with the counterweight of stress balance when being used to overturn.
The utility model improves the tipper that carpenter in the prior art uses, and through automatic clamping device and the switching mechanism of setting up, the respective outer side edges of importing live roll platform, outputting power roller platform, effectively is clamped on the flip-arm sheet material and 180 degree upsets; Avoid existing in the switching process flip-arm and sheet material bump, guarantee the integrality of sheet material, and the sheet material that can overturn according to the sized auto lock plate surface of sheet material; Usage space increases greatly; Use flexibly, strengthen automation control, avoid the too much manpower and the input of material resources; Effectively guarantee personal safety, effectively enhance productivity.

The specific embodiment
Below in conjunction with accompanying drawing the utility model is done further to describe.
According to Fig. 1, Fig. 2, shown in Figure 3; The single armed tipper that the said carpenter of the utility model uses; It comprises frame 1, is installed on drive controlling mechanism 2, input live roll platform 3, outputting power roller platform 4 and switching mechanism 5 on the frame 1, and input live roll platform 3, outputting power roller platform 4 are connected with drive controlling mechanism 2 respectively.This drive controlling mechanism 2 is made up of drive motors 21, rotating band 22, driving-chain 23; Rotating band 22 is connected with driving-chain 23; Driving-chain 23 is connected with the motor shaft of drive motors 21; Drive motors 21 is installed on the frame 1, and rotating band 22 is connected with input live roll platform 3, outputting power roller platform 4 respectively, and drive motors 21 drives driving-chain 23 runnings; Drive input live roll platform 3,4 operations of outputting power roller platform simultaneously, and switching mechanism 5 is arranged at the middle part of input live roll platform 3, outputting power roller platform 4.
Wherein, switching mechanism 5 is provided with the flip-arm 6 of the sheet material that is used to more than two groups or two groups to overturn, and flip-arm 6 is provided with the automatic clamping device 7 more than two or two.This automatic clamping device 7 is fixedly installed on the flip-arm 6.When sheet material is delivered on the flip-arm 6, automatic clamping device 7 lock onto sheet material on the flip-arm 6, and switching mechanism 5 drives flip-arms 6 rotations, turn on the outputting power roller platform 4 thereby make the sheet material that is clamped on the flip-arm 6 carry out 180 degree by input live roll platform 3.
According to above-mentioned qualification; Switching mechanism 5 comprises upset motor 51, trip shaft 52; Trip shaft 52, upset motor 51 are fixed in input live roll platform 3 and outputting power roller platform 4 middle parts through support; Upset motor 51 is installed on the top of trip shaft 52, and trip shaft 52 is connected with the motor 51 that overturns, and flip-arm 6 is fixedly installed in respectively on the trip shaft 52.That is, during 51 operations of upset motor, drive trip shaft 52 rotations, rotate on the outputting power roller platform 4 thereby drive flip-arm 6 carries out 180 degree by input live roll platform 3.According to actual manufacturing, the utility model flip-arm 6 framework setting that is square, it comprises side frame 61, side frame 62, left frame 63 and right frame 64 down.This automatic clamping device 7 is installed on the last side frame 61 of flip-arm 6, and the following side frame of flip-arm 6 62 no matter with 4 of 3 of input live roll platforms or outputting power roller platforms on, following side frame 62 respectively with 4 of 3 of input live roll platforms, outputting power roller platform each other side by side.
According to above-mentioned further qualification, the automatic clamping device 7 of the utility model clamps cylinder and is fixed on the last side frame 61 of flip-arm 6 through securing member for clamping cylinder.In order fully to clamp sheet material, on side frame 61 on the flip-arm 6, be equipped with two and clamp cylinders, these two piston rods that clamp cylinders are respectively toward the left side or the right side of last side frame 61, and the piston rod that clamps cylinder is provided with the roof pressure piece 9 that is used to lock sheet material.
That is, when sheet material is delivered in the framework of flip-arm 6 by input live roll platform 3, clamps cylinder 7 operations and promote piston rod and promote downwards, roof pressure piece 9 is contacted with plate surface, and roof pressure piece 9 roof pressure sheet materials, sheet material tightly is connected with the following side frame 62 of flip-arm 6.At this moment, trip shaft 52 makes the flip-arm 6 that is installed on the trip shaft 52 rotated to outputting power roller platform 4 by input live roll platform 3 under the drive of upset motor 51, realizes that sheet material is turn on 4 of the outputting power roller platforms by 3 180 degree of input live roll platform.When sheet material arrives 4 when lasting of outputting power roller platform, clamp cylinder 7 control piston bars and move up, roof pressure piece 9 disengaging plate surfaces; Sheet material is delivered to next manufacturing procedure through the operation of outputting power roller platform 4, thereby effectively avoids in switching process, the phenomenon that sheet material and flip-arm 6 bump; Guarantee the sheet material integrality, and be fit to the sheet material of the various different sizes of upset, usage space increases greatly; Use flexibly, automation intensity is stronger.
In order to be more suitable for the use of various different size sheet materials, the sheet material of large-scale especially weight, the utility model is provided with counterweight 10 on the right frame 64 of flip-arm 6; Under the combination of counterweight 10; Make sheet material in switching process, stressed balance more makes rotary movement stable.And trip shaft 52 ends are provided with the electrical signal device 8 that is used to control reversal rate, have the control rotary movement that the switch of acceleration-deceleration is arranged on this electrical signal device 8, reduce flip-arm 6 and produce the phenomenon of shake, and are more stable when making its upset.
